sibi eventurum, id contigit, ut salvi poteremur domi.
victores victis hostibus legiones reveniunt domum,
duello exstincto maximo atque internecatis hostibus.

What I never dreamed would happen nor anyone else on our
side, either, has happened, and here we are safe and sound.
(_magnificently_) Our legions come back victorious, our
foes vanquished, a mighty contest concluded and our enemies
massacred to a man.

quod multa Thebano poplo acerba obiecit funera, 190
id vi et virtute militum victum atque expugnatum oppidum est
imperio atque auspicio eri mei Amphitruonis maxime.
praeda atque agro adoriaque adfecit populares suos
regique Thebano Creoni regnum stabilivit suom.

The town that has brought an untimely death to many a
Theban citizen has been crushed and captured by the strength
and valour of our soldiery, aye, and chiefly under the
command and auspices of my own master, Amphitryon. He has
furnished forth his countrymen with booty and land and fame,
and fixed King Creon firm upon his Theban throne.
